Modelo simples de um projeto em R
para melhor organização das funções, dados e reports.
- main.r: Script principal que chamará as funções construídas para realizar as tarefas desejadas.
- load_functions.r: Script com função
load_functions()
que carrega todas as demais funções salvas na pastafunctions
. - /functions: Pasta que deverá conter scripts com as funções a serem utilizadas.
- O nome da função deve representar bem a tarefa que a mesma realiza.
- De preferência, construir funções pequenas e, assim, "especialistas" em suas tarefas.
- Organizar grupos de funções em arquivos .R diferentes.
Todas essas medidas tendem a oferecer um código mais limpo, organizado e fácil de entender e dar mauntenção.
Lucas Emanuel |